8th Grade ELA finished reading The Outsiders today, so they kind of recreated a scene from the book. We had our own Greaser vs Soc Rumble in the form of a chocolate cake eating contest! Here's what happened: 1) We got a few boxes of Ding Dongs(Mrs. Smith made chocolate cakes for everyone else in class to enjoy) 2) Since this was our dress-up day, the kids selected one greaser and one Soc to represent them in the rumble. 3) The contestants had to unwrap and eat all of their ding dongs. 4) The winner gets their choice of SODAPOP! 😂 It was such a fun activity. Messy, but fun. And the dirty socs won BOTH TIMES. 😫 You'll get 'em next time, Greasers.
